Page 1 of 2

Console Stats not populating

Posted: Tue Sep 26, 2023 9:43 pm
by Frank Dux
Just ran first successful cleanup and noted that the Stats screen had not populated.

I did a quick look and did not find this referenced anywhere else.

- Date occurred: 27/09/2023
- MBBS v10 Release number: MBBS v10 Beta R32
- System load/usage at time of crash (if known): Low
- Can you reproduce the crash? If so, how?: Does not crash; just an OCD observation.
- Did you recently make any changes to your system such as adding new modules or changing configuration? First successful cleanup.

Re: Console Stats not populating

Posted: Sat Sep 30, 2023 10:58 pm
by Duckula
Did the stats generate on the second cleanup?

Re: Console Stats not populating

Posted: Sun Oct 01, 2023 2:44 am
by Frank Dux
I have not had the server running consecutively for 2 straight days. Since then, have upgraded the host to Windows 10 and now the server wont complete a cleanup or shutdown without a windows error.

Same files are fine on Windows 7. Have not been able to locate the problem. Have reverted back to WG3 for the time being.

A successful BBSV10 shutdown on Windows 7 looked like this in the audit logs:
----------------------------------------------------------------------------------------------------
20230928 134318 SERVER SHUTDOWN Console
20230928 134318 DialChat: Saving channels U# 0100 DialChat! 2.6
20230928 134318 DialChat: Cleaning Bulletins U# 0100 DialChat! 2.6
20230928 134318 DialChat: Done with cleanup. U# 0100 DialChat! 2.6
20230928 134318 ELW Hi-Rollers Shutdown Started Console Hi-Rollers Shutdown started.
20230928 134320 ELW Hi-Rollers Shutdown Closed Console Hi-Rollers shutdown completed.
...
---------------------------------------------------------------------------------------------------

When shutdown on Windows 10, it only goes this far:
----------------------------------------------------------------------------------------------------
20230928 134318 SERVER SHUTDOWN Console
20230928 134318 DialChat: Saving channels U# 0100 DialChat! 2.6
20230928 134318 DialChat: Cleaning Bulletins U# 0100 DialChat! 2.6
20230928 134318 DialChat: Done with cleanup. U# 0100 DialChat! 2.6
---------------------------------------------------------------------------------------------------

Still tinkering. Will require some module disabling to troubleshoot.

I'll restore the Win7 snapshot and initiate 2 consecutive clean ups and test the stat creation component.

Re: Console Stats not populating

Posted: Sun Oct 01, 2023 7:15 am
by Duckula
Yes I would recommend disabling modules to see which one is causing the problem.

Once identified let us know and we will see what can be done.

Maybe start with ELW hi-rollers as it is the first one that isn't present on Windows 10.

Re: Console Stats not populating

Posted: Sun Oct 01, 2023 11:52 pm
by Frank Dux
I just found out it's DialChat - I can confirm that stats populate on or around the 2nd cleanup. Ran 3 consecutive cleanups and a successful shutdown whist DialChat was disabled.

Re-enabled DialChat and on it's 2nd shutdown, it bricks the board. Needs to be second - first shutdown with DialChat is fine - but consistently the second one causes errors. I have sent additional details including screens to Support.

So stats do populat on 2nd cleanup. Thank you.

Re: Console Stats not populating

Posted: Wed Oct 04, 2023 8:18 pm
by Frank Dux
Update: Day 4 of consecutive uptime and still no stats.

During the course of my testing, I was initiating manual cleanups to simulate module behaviour during cleanup. It is possible stats are only being populated first time during a manual cleanup?

Re: Console Stats not populating

Posted: Mon Oct 09, 2023 12:05 am
by Frank Dux
After over a week of non populating, I copied the files across to the Staging server, changed IPADDR accordingly, ran a manual cleanup and stats populated for October correctly.

Copied files back to the Live Server, changed IPADDR accordingly. Will monitor for stat changes over coming days.

Re: Console Stats not populating

Posted: Mon Oct 09, 2023 8:15 pm
by Frank Dux
Stats appear to be recorded but aren't being correctly displayed on the console.

Having spent days on this now, if you found this post because you're having the same issue - do not migrate your board. Start from a new install and rebuild from scratch or upgrade only and ignore the clutter that v10 does not use.

Re: Console Stats not populating

Posted: Tue Oct 10, 2023 12:12 am
by Ragtop
Hey Frank, Just wanted to add my experience to this. I moved my board from an XP to Win 10 about a year ago. Did full 3.2 install to the new server to ensure all registry variables were installed, copied my backup to it, then upgraded to v10. No problem with stats at all. Only issue I had was the console display being all jumbled. Fixed this by choosing "Use Legacy Console" in the window options.

Did you install it this way, or just copy your backup over? If not, I suggest trying it. Hopefully, that fixes your issue.

Re: Console Stats not populating

Posted: Tue Oct 10, 2023 9:41 pm
by Frank Dux
Hey Ragtop,

Appreciate the input.

This is a new full install of v10 and relevant board history (Forum, Files, Email, etc) DATs moved 1 module at a time. Once the board was operational, then each ISV module (including mine) was also migrated 1 by 1 and tested for access, shutdown and cleanup behaviour. This way I was able to identity some modules not previously listed. It also resulted in a very clean structure compared to that of the board's history of MBBS->WG20->WG3.

Duckula has been fantastic in his pursuit of finding the cause and looks like we have narrowed the issue down to WGSPSTAT.EXE not generating the .BIN files on the Live environment (they get created in Staging). The stats are all being recorded correctly, just the top 4: Lines-in-use, Calls/Baud, Time used/hr and Time used/g# not updating correctly in the consolve view after cleanup.